Knarvik vidaregåande skule is a high school located on Knarvik in Lindås, 30 km north of Bergen in Norway. The school is one of the largest in Hordaland with over 950 pupils and ca. 150 employees. The school offers close connection to local industry where pupils attend a program called TAF that eventually leads to both craftmanship and a high school degree in 4 years.
